Transaction 2695999ebee4c972942b25fe18c21989887572ede250310ec2d8c61f8090a872
1 Input
1 Output
-
2695999ebee4c972942b25fe18c21989887572ede250310ec2d8c61f8090a872:0
- value
- 435579
- script pubkey
- OP_0 OP_PUSHBYTES_20 78457fbd71ef7ca6b7828588a4e43dbfd895c75b
- address
- bc1q0pzhl0t3aa72dduzsky2fepahlvft36myzw8d7